The Orange and Blue begin their outdoor title pursuits at the conference championships.
LEXINGTON, Ky. – Florida Gators Track and Field is set to compete in the SEC Outdoor Track and Field Championships, hosted by the University of Kentucky, beginning on Thursday, May 15 and continuing through Saturday, May 17.
The Women’s program is in pursuit of their first conference title since 2022, and the Gator men will look to take home the trophy for the first time since 2018.
